Idaho Permit Test FAQs:

How do I get driver’s permit in Idaho?

If your driver’s license has been expired for more than a year, or it’s your first license, you must apply for a learner’s permit, or Supervised Instruction Permit, in Idaho. This requires a written exam on safe driving techniques, traffic signs and motor vehicle laws.

Once you get this valid permit, you must then pass a vision test as well as a road skills test in order to obtain an Idaho driver’s license. If you are under 17 years of age, you must hold a learner’s permit for at least 6 months and complete a state approved driver training program. Before taking the road skills test, you must also show a certificate of completion of 50 hours of supervised driving time.

I have recently moved to Idaho. How do I get the driver’s license?

If you are a new resident in Idaho, and you have an out-of-state license, you must get an Idaho driver’s license within 90 days of moving to the state. You must obtain a license within 30 days if you have a Commercial Driver’s License (CDL). You will be required to surrender your out-of-state license in order to get the new one, so be sure that you bring it with you to the DMV.

You will need to pass the vision screening test but you will not be required to do the written test or the road skills test to exchange your out-of-state license for an Idaho license. However, if your license from the former state expired more than a year prior, you will need to pass the vision test.

I am from the overseas. Do I have to apply for the Idaho driver’s license?

For one year from the date of your arrival you may drive using a valid foreign driver’s license. It is also encouraged that you hold an International Driving Permit that was issued by your country of residence. However, if you establish residency in Idaho, you are then required to apply for an Idaho driver’s license, which means you will need to pass the vision test, written exam and road skills test.
